Maybe its hitting D-1 teams differently. After seeing so much consensus, I went back and re-checked my numbers and here's what I've got for my D-III team in Naismith:
Season 42- This was my first season and I didn't record my final team ratings, but we were s-l-o-w. I added the press component so my IQ's sucked and depending on the matchup, I didn't even run the press half of things in some games. TO's forced per game-15.3, Steals per game 7.2.
Season 43- Ath. 44, Spd. 36, Def. 46...16.17 TO pg, 9.13 Spg
Season 44-Ath. 47, Spd. 42, Def. 47...16.68 TO pg, 9.06 Spg
Season 45 (new engine) -- Counting my two exhibition games, I've played 15 games under the new engine, so far I'm averaging 16.47 TO pg, very much in line with the two previous seasons (My current values are 49 Ath, 42 Spd, 44 Def.). My steals per game have fallen to 7.57, but again, this supposedly was going to occur across the board to some degree to move the totals back in line with their actual incidence in NCAA basketball. The turnover number, so far, has stayed consistent.
